On 06.06.2017 17:22, Greg Kurz wrote:
> The string returned by object_property_get_str() is dynamically allocated.
> 
> (Spotted by Coverity, CID 1375942)
> 
> Signed-off-by: Greg Kurz <address@hidden>
> ---
>  hw/ppc/spapr.c |    5 ++++-
>  1 file changed, 4 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
> 
> diff --git a/hw/ppc/spapr.c b/hw/ppc/spapr.c
> index 86e622834f63..f834a6a7dfac 100644
> --- a/hw/ppc/spapr.c
> +++ b/hw/ppc/spapr.c
> @@ -2617,8 +2617,11 @@ static void spapr_memory_pre_plug(HotplugHandler 
> *hotplug_dev, DeviceState *dev,
>      if (mem_dev && !kvmppc_is_mem_backend_page_size_ok(mem_dev)) {
>          error_setg(errp, "Memory backend has bad page size. "
>                     "Use 'memory-backend-file' with correct mem-path.");
> -        return;
> +        goto out;
>      }
> +
> +out:
> +    g_free(mem_dev);
>  }

You don't need the goto and the "out" label here.
